Transaction f21ec336ece72445d8f541712a17c5df18167a1f1aaafaaa27e910688e97e116

1 Input
2 Outputs
  • f21ec336ece72445d8f541712a17c5df18167a1f1aaafaaa27e910688e97e116:0
  • value  74858777
    address  14ptAiypgEDFc68DsjG5HybfsqE87C96nc
  • f21ec336ece72445d8f541712a17c5df18167a1f1aaafaaa27e910688e97e116:1
  • value  1366101
    address  1HGpvEe9RJRTSSbhjFM89JfNH7AUqvHaeE